River View Residence is a peaceful riverside hotel in Bangkok’s historic Talad Noi district, close to Chinatown, Hua Lamphong MRT, and other local attractions. All rooms feature windows, air-conditioning, hot showers, a fridge, and free Wi-Fi. Room types include Standard, Deluxe, Exclusive (with river view), Family, and Monthly Residence. Guests can enjoy panoramic views of the Chao Phraya River at River Vibe Restaurant & Bar on the 8th and rooftop 9th floor, open daily from 7:30 AM to 11:00 PM. The elevator reaches the 8th floor; rooftop access requires one flight of stairs. There is no parking on-site. For taxi drop-off, please search for “Soi Duangtawan” on Google Maps. KKantabuliyazhangchangzongI was quite hesitant about this hotel after reading the reviews, but after staying there, I can say its location is excellent, right by the river. The biggest selling point is definitely the riverside access, especially the free shuttle boat. This shuttle can take you to S-pier, which connects to all the major blue and orange line attractions. Taking the metro isn't the most convenient option, but you can also get to S-pier and transfer there. From my window, I could see the Ferris wheel, and there's a night market right downstairs. However, the shuttle service ends at 9 PM, which is a big drawback, as it's about a 5-minute walk from there. Also, if you're close to the river at night, you might hear the rumble of boats in the middle of the night. While the hotel facilities are a bit old, they're not dirty. I loved the bed – it was incredibly soft and comfortable; I honestly didn't want to get up! The beds are huge. Even though they're single beds, two pushed together are bigger than beds in China, easily sleeping three people. I skipped the hotel breakfast as I'd already spent a lot of money these past few days. In the afternoon, there's hot coffee in the lobby, which is a nice touch (though it's the only one). They also have iced water, chrysanthemum tea, and roselle tea, plus some biscuits. In the mornings, there are croissants and hot coffee that you can take with you. It's like a simple meal, and it's not bad at all. One of the front desk staff speaks Chinese, so communication wasn't an issue. The hotel requires a deposit, as it's a major international brand. The bottled water in the room is complimentary and NSF certified, so feel free to drink up. The razor provided was quite good, and the water pressure in the shower was strong. From 9:30 PM to 10:00 PM, there's a singer performing in the lobby, which you can discreetly listen to. There's also legitimate massage available outside. If you get hungry at night, there's a 7-Eleven and some street food stalls about 50 to 100 meters away. I wouldn't say the food is amazing or terrible, but you can try the oyster omelet. As for the swimming pool, it's actually quite nice, being on the first floor and very spacious. If your main goal is to explore along the river, this hotel is perfect. However, if you're looking to frequent places like Nana, this location might not be ideal.

NNari.I recently spent several nights at the Furama Silom Hotel in Bangkok, and if you are looking for a blend of convenience, space, and local flavor, this property is a solid contender. Located on the bustling Silom Road, the hotel stands as a prominent choice for both leisure travelers and business professionals who want to be in the thick of Bangkok’s financial and nightlife district. Spacious Living in a Prime Location The first thing that struck me about Furama Silom is the sheer size of the rooms. In a city where many modern hotels are trending toward compact ”minimalist” spaces, Furama offers an expansive environment. My room was bright, featuring floor-to-ceiling windows that provided a fantastic view of the city skyline. The inclusion of a kitchenette was a thoughtful touch, making it feel more like an apartment than a standard hotel room. The location is undoubtedly the hotel's strongest selling point. It is roughly a 10-minute walk to both the Saint Louis and Chong Nonsi BTS stations, making the rest of the city easily accessible. For those who enjoy exploring on foot, the famous Patpong Night Market, the historic Sri Maha Mariamman Temple, and a plethora of local street food stalls and 7-Eleven stores are just a short stroll away. Rooftop Relaxation and Dining The highlight of the stay was the rooftop swimming pool on the 20th floor. It offers a stunning 360-degree panoramic view of Bangkok, which is particularly breathtaking at sunset. There is also a poolside bar where you can unwind with a cocktail after a long day of sightseeing. Regarding the breakfast buffet, it served a decent variety of Western and Asian dishes. While the menu stayed relatively consistent each day, the quality was good, and the dining area provided a welcoming atmosphere to start the morning. Service and Hospitality The staff at Furama Silom deserve a special mention. From the concierge to the housekeeping team, the service was warm and professional. Check-in was efficient, and they were always ready to assist with taxi bookings or local recommendations. Their hospitality truly embodies the ”Land of Smiles.” Points for Consideration While my stay was overall very positive, it is worth noting that the hotel has a bit of a ”vintage” feel. Some parts of the interior show their age, with slightly dated carpets and furniture. However, the hotel is clearly undergoing maintenance and renovations to address this, and given the competitive pricing, the value for money remains exceptionally high. Verdict I would recommend Furama Silom Hotel to travelers who prioritize location and space over ultra-modern luxury. It is a practical, comfortable, and friendly base for exploring everything Bangkok has to offer. Whether you are here for a short business trip or a week-long vacation, it provides a reliable and pleasant experience.
